Rilakkuma and friends are joining SASUKE Ninja Warrior for a merchandise line tied to the World Cup 2026 season. Shirts, towels, stickers, keychains, folders, and tin cases are available through TBS's online shop, with prices from 385 yen to 3,960 yen. The collaboration was announced on August 6.
Rilakkuma has traded his usual calm for the obstacle course. The San-X character is now dressed as a ninja, alongside Korilakkuma, Chairoi Koguma, and Kiiroitori, in a merchandise line celebrating SASUKE Ninja Warrior World Cup 2026. The items, which include shirts, face towels, stickers, acrylic keychains, clear file folders, and a tin case, are listed on TBS's online shop at prices from 385 yen to 3,960 yen.
The announcement follows the August 24 broadcast of the second SASUKE Ninja Warrior World Cup, where eight teams competed in a point and elimination format. Team United States captain Daniel Gil won the final stage against Japan Red captain Yusuke Morimoto.
